Research Backgrounds

Function:

Dual regulator of transcription and autophagy. Positively regulates autophagy and is required for autophagosome formation and processing. May act as a scaffold protein that recruits MAP1LC3A, GABARAP and GABARAPL2 and brings them to the autophagosome membrane by interacting with VMP1 where, in cooperation with the BECN1-PI3-kinase class III complex, they trigger autophagosome development. Acts as a transcriptional activator of THRA.

Subcellular Location:

Cytoplasm>Cytosol. Nucleus. Nucleus>PML body. Cytoplasmic vesicle>Autophagosome.
Note: Shuttles between the nucleus and the cytoplasm, depending on cellular stress conditions, and re-localizes to autophagosomes on autophagy activation.

Subunit Structure:

Interacts with VMP1, GABARAP, GABARAPL1, GABARAPL2, MAP1LC3A, MAP1LC3B, MAP1LC3C and THRA.

Family&Domains:

The LC3 interacting region (LIR) motif mediates interaction with GABARAP, GABARAPL1, GABARAPL2, MAP1LC3A, MAP1LC3B and MAP1LC3C.
